Leslie "Les"FREEFREE Leslie "Les" Passed away peacefully at home after a long battle with Parkinsons. He will be sadly missed by his wife Bernadette, Son Brian, Daughter in Law Claire, Grandchildren Kate and Liam, Great Grandchildren Cody and Kingsley. Forever in our hearts, sleep with the angels until we meet again. The funeral will be held in St Marys Church, Whitchurch at 12:00pm on Friday 2nd August followed by a burial service at Thornhill Cemetery. All who knew him are welcome to attend no black ties, smart casual colours please. Family flowers only. Donations kindly welcome to Cystic Fibrosis Trust c/o DJ Evans Forse, Whitchurch.
